    Quote Originally Posted by joecar View Post
    That will not work because the cam 4x sequence (i.e. the cam sprocket and distributor) spins at half crank speed.
    Yes I know this is an old post, just don't like mis-information on the internet. Yes his idea will work, he was on the correct path.

    Because its on the distributor and cams turn at 1/2 speed, so.... the answer to the riddle is just print the 58x pattern twice on that wheel you designed and it will work perfectly.
